Martha Ann Saffold Schenk, age 82 of Monticello, went to be with her Lord and Savior Thursday, February 12, 2026, at Belle View Nursing and Rehab in Monticello. She was born November 20, 1943, in Monticello, AR to the late Marvin Edward Saffold and Hazel McQuiston Saffold.
She was the secretary for James Schenk Farms, Inc. and longtime member and Children’s Sunday School teacher at Rose Hill Cumberland Presbyterian Church. Mrs. Martha was a homemaker that loved gardening and canning. She was also an EHC Drew County Fair and Election poll worker volunteer but most of all, she enjoyed spending time with her family and grandchildren.
She is survived by her husband of 57 years, James Edward Schenk, Sr. of Monticello; her children, Deborah Schenk Yount and husband Chris of Wilmar, Donna Gail Schenk and James Edward Schenk, Jr. and wife Angela all of Monticello; four brothers, Kenneth Saffold and wife Hazel of Monticello, Bill Saffold and wife Gail of Pine Bluff, Dale Saffold of London and Barry Saffold and fiancé Michelle of Star City; one sister, Betty Saffold Weatherly of Monticello; her grandchildren, Brianna Yount Smith (Noah) of Star City and James Casper Schenk; along with numerous nieces, nephews and cousins.
